Sarah Dash who sang on 'Lady Marmalade' with Labelle, dies

Sarah Dash who sang on 'Lady Marmalade' with Labelle, dies

NEW YORK (AP) — Singer Sarah Dash, who co-founded the all-female group Labelle — best known for the raucous 1974 hit “Lady Marmalade" — has died. She was 76. Patti Labelle and Nona Hendryx completed the trio.
